Sherry-Netherland co-op in Plaza District borrows $10.7M in new debt from Union Fidelity
The Sherry-Netherland cooperative hotel through the entity The Sherry-Netherland, Inc. as borrower signed a loan agreement with lender Union Fidelity Life Insurance Company valued at $10.7 million for 1 parcel, including the tax class cooperative (D4) and containing 169 residential units at 781 Fifth Avenue in the Plaza District. The deal closed on July 2, 2020 and was recorded on August 5, 2020.
The property contains a total of 314,509 square feet of built space.
The average loan per unit is $63,314.
This new debt is on top of existing loans of $21 million and $4 million that Union Fidelity previously gave to Sherry-Netherland.
Michael Ullman, COO of Sherry-Netherland, was the signatory.
Over the past five years, there have been 30 NYC Department of Buildings permit applications filed for this parcel valued at more than $20,000. There were 30 renovation/alteration projects (A2) applied for with a total estimated value of $11,628,675.
